datagrid不能显示数据
我用的是C#英文正式版,OLEDBCONNECTION、OLEDBDATAADAPTER(SELECT * FROM CUSTOMERS,PREVIEW DATA有91ROWS)建立成功,同时用GENERATE DATASET产生DATASET1,然后在FORM是添加DATAGRID1,将其DATASOURCE设为DATASET1.CUSTOMERS,可运行起来就是不显示数据,只是什么NULL,不明白????? 问题点数:20、回复次数:8Top
1 楼coldljy(青山隐隐)回复于 2002-03-09 09:49:21 得分 0
要Bind一下
DATAGRID1.Bind();Top
2 楼coldljy(青山隐隐)回复于 2002-03-09 09:56:39 得分 0
写错了,是DataBindTop
3 楼twkwang()回复于 2002-03-09 16:27:31 得分 0
好像都不行,根本就没有DATABIND OR BINDTop
4 楼cashcho(天下第七)回复于 2002-03-09 17:25:05 得分 0
要在事件中添加DataBind(),如果是web form(asp.net)那就放在(比如)Page_Load事件代码中,如果是winform就可以放到Button_Click里Top
5 楼wenzm(魔术师)回复于 2002-03-10 17:46:36 得分 0
好像是datagrid1.setdatabind()
Top
6 楼virtual_gene(虚拟基因)回复于 2002-03-11 00:31:42 得分 20
加入类似代码:
sqlDataAdapter1.Fill(thedataSet);
dataGrid1.SetDataBinding (thedataSet.Tables"theTable"].DefaultView ,"");Top
7 楼virtual_gene(虚拟基因)回复于 2002-03-11 00:33:03 得分 0
我用的版本是Visual studio 7.0,中文版Top
8 楼wenzm(魔术师)回复于 2002-03-11 11:45:01 得分 0
virtual_gene(虚拟基因)的方法正确Top




